2. Challenges Of Reusing Solar Panels
It is widely approved that reusing photovoltaic panels has several environmental benefits, nonetheless, it is also true that the procedure isn't without its obstacles. Yet exactly what are these challenges? Let's examine additionally.
Among the greatest problems with recycling photovoltaic panels is the complexity of the job itself. It can be tough to break down the different elements, such as glass and steel, to be recycled individually. In addition, photovoltaic panel suppliers commonly have a mix of materials made use of in their products which makes arranging them much more difficult. Additionally, there are safety and wellness dangers included with handling busted glass or inhaling fumes from thawing parts.
Another crucial challenge related to reusing solar panels is cost. Lots of nations do not have sufficient framework or sources to adequately reuse these items which causes greater expenditures for businesses attempting to do so. Moreover, because of the specialized nature of recycling solar panels, this can produce a financial concern on firms attempting to remain certified with guidelines. Inevitably, these expenses could be passed down to customers making it hard for them to manage renewable energy sources.

3. Strategies For Reusing Solar Panels
As the world pursues a more lasting future, recycling photovoltaic panels is a significantly prominent job. Among this expanding passion, however, we should think about the approaches that are in location to make it feasible.
To begin with, many business have actually carried out a 'take-back' system where old or damaged photovoltaic panels can be gathered and sent out to their particular factories for reusing. By doing this, the materials have the ability to be recycled in the building and construction of brand-new products. Furthermore, some towns have actually even started offering motivations for individuals wanting to reuse their solar panels; this can vary from tax obligation breaks to free delivery prices.
Additionally, innovation has actually become progressively sophisticated when it concerns recycling photovoltaic panels-- with specialist equipments with the ability of separating out all the various parts within them. For instance, by utilizing AI-powered robotic arms, these devices can draw out helpful products such as copper and aluminium while likewise throwing away hazardous waste securely.
